[Powered by Google Translate] CHRISTOPHER Bartholomew: Selamat kembali. Dalam video lain, kami membincangkan jenis data char dalam C yang boleh digunakan untuk memegang huruf, nombor dan aksara khas seperti soalan atau tanda seru. Kita tahu bahawa char individu mempunyai nilai ASCII, yang adalah perwakilan integer watak. Sebagai contoh, nilai ASCII huruf A adalah 65. Tetapi dalam C, apa yang kita gunakan untuk perkataan sebenar atau hukuman seperti sebagai pengaturcaraan, atau "C adalah cantik?" Jawapannya adalah rentetan - tetapi untuk menjadi lebih khusus, ia adalah rentetan aksara. Satu rentetan aksara, atau tali, adalah satu urutan bait aksara yang disimpan bersama-sama antara satu sama lain dalam ingatan. Dan pada akhir mana-mana rentetan aksara di C bahasa, terdapat satu bait tambahan yang diperuntukkan bagi watak khas - backslash 0, yang merupakan watak penamatan batal. Watak penamatan nol ialah char 1 bait yang bit semua adalah 0 dan ia digunakan untuk memberi isyarat akhir rentetan dalam ingatan. Ini bermakna sama ada anda bercadang untuk memulakan rentetan anda sebagai hukuman "C adalah menyeronokkan," atau hanya perkataan "seronok," di akhir akan sentiasa ada watak penamatan batal menunjukkan bahawa rentetan telah berakhir. Untuk menggunakan rentetan dalam program anda, ia disyorkan bahawa anda memulakan pembolehubah anda seperti ini - carta bintang S bersamaan quote terbuka, tali anda, berhampiran quote, koma bernoktah. Dalam takrif ini pembolehubah, pembolehubah S mata yang pertama watak dalam rentetan kami, yang ialah C. Anda lihat, kerana kita kini tahu keseluruhan rentetan disimpan berurutan dalam ingatan, kita boleh mendapatkan semula tali dengan tidak ada masalah kerana kita juga tahu di mana ia berakhir, terlalu - penamatan huruf null. Jadi bersenang-senang. Saya Christopher Bartholomew, ini adalah cs50.